Roof pitch is the rise of the roof over the run of the roof.
The roof pitching is essentially how steep the roof is going to be they are either going to be flat or pitched.
The steeper the roof the more quickly it will be able to shed rain and other debris.
That is to say the roof pitch expressed as a ratio tells you how many inches the roof rises for every 12 inches of depth.
The denominator or second number denotes the horizontal length measurement of the roof.
Even flat roofs aren t completely flat because they must be constructed at a very slight incline so rain can be directed away from the roof.
